Campers find sites that balance privacy with coastal views, some shaded by dense pine stands that muffle evening conversations and footsteps. Tent pads settle on sandy soil peppered with pine needles, and the absence of pavement encourages close connection with the earth beneath. Vault toilets and cold-water spigots provide basic conveniences without intruding on the natural feel. Most sites allow easy access for smaller rigs, though larger vehicles navigate narrow, winding access roads with care. Cell signals are spotty, inviting guests to trade screen time for star gazing beneath clear, expansive skies.
